Transaction 50f20c4e99ca5308a28ad5b5c511e468cdabbde9152ea168cefbaedbd70c59ab

1 Input
2 Outputs
  • 50f20c4e99ca5308a28ad5b5c511e468cdabbde9152ea168cefbaedbd70c59ab:0
  • value  166677189
    address  bc1qrs3ycd7z48tumct65lr47thchld2c2dfcrtk99
  • 50f20c4e99ca5308a28ad5b5c511e468cdabbde9152ea168cefbaedbd70c59ab:1
  • value  3007499
    address  17E6hieWjXFaZbJVVJ15hWjaiWTGC8ARh3